Looking for help on sizing. I am going to buy a new Wilson and have only been able to ride a medium. It felt a little on the small size. I am 5'11" and have always ridden a medium, but this one feels cramped. So my question is does anyone have any experience on a large, are they that much bigger than the mediums? I am nervous because I will be ordering from fanatik Online and don't have access to try a large before I pull the trigger.

I have pedaled a M at Sea Otter this year around their booth and it felt spot on for me. I am 5'10 and am on a M V10c atm. I also sat on a friend's L 2012 Wilson and it felt similar to my M V10; with that I felt the M V10 is just a hair roomier than my previous bike, a 2010 SX Trail. I honestly feel I could ride a L Wilson, but just personal pref. on wanting a tighter cockpit. I am getting a 28/30mm stem coz I just feel a lil stretched out...
My friend who owns the L Wilson is like 6, 6'1 if that helps you out...

I'm 5'9" and I am squarely in the medium size of pretty much all bikes. The only exceptions are bikes that are really small or really big. I am on a medium Wilson and previously on a medium GT Fury/Revolt/Sunday/V10. Assuming you are pretty evenly proportioned, you could probably go with either a medium or large based on personal preference.
